WebCalculating FOV Using a Lens with a Fixed Magnification Example 2: For an application using a ½” sensor, which has a horizontal sensor size of 6.4mm, a horizontal FOV of 25mm is desired. m = 6.4mm 25mm m = 0.256X m = 6.4 mm 25 mm m = 0.256 X By reviewing a list of fixed magnification or telecentric lenses, a proper magnification can be selected.

Magnification is the quotient of the focal length of the objective lens and the focal length of the eyepiece.
